mp3批量下载conditionalonproperty 用法prefixwhite food
ConditionalonProperty用于制定类或者方法的属性值的条件,一般情况下在业务代码里,需要针对不同的环境,做相应的处理;这个时候可以使用ConditionalOnProperty注解来注释将对应的类或者方法只有在满足条件时才会装配到容器中。
我的初中生活
syne ConditionalOnProperty注解使用时,可以有一个参数,前缀prefix,prefix用来定义当前要检验的属性的前缀,如果想要判断某个特定属性的值,就可以使用prefix来限定,只有匹配的属性才会通过检验。
chiller
prefix会更加灵活,能够更加准确的匹配,否则想要检验的属性有很多时,就会检验多个,从而影响性能。prefix可以通过通配符*来实现,也可以使用正则表达式。
暂存 prefix的形式一般是:
prefix='key=value'chengling>大连英语老师
prefix='key1=value1,key2=value2'管子英文
esb
prefix='key1=value1,key2='
其中,当只有key1的时候,则代表如果有key1的属性,就会被注入;当key2也有值的时候,就限定了key2的属性值必须和value2相同,才会被注入;如果key2没值,则只检验key1,key2的值不做检验。